I have never had to diagnose Aris yet with a problem. If you have a universal pulse with modulator generator . Like one for testing fuel injectors You can feed a signal to the valve duty cycle, 30%, 50% 80% And you will see the pressures change on your gauge as you do this . I’m not sure what the factory manual says for testing Ohm reading but usually there’s somewhere around 11 ohms plus a minus a little bit read the manual specifications but it’s Toyota. They probably don’t give a spec maybe. . But sometimes they can pass the resistance test and after they’re an operation and they get hot from operation from a little while then the windings can open up or short . So sometimes a static test doesn’t show a problem. The thermal expanding of the copper windings will make the problem appear later.
